Output 9aa5c15a66c64a8620e94cb7d1337fcb28a41653269576567cede6d51fd40dbb:101
- value
- 1505906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 244bfcd78715eecb05b7d818407fe4364898781e OP_EQUAL
- address
- 34zwHAXb6sxP5irpXJCr5aTC7LPkMYbf9F
- transaction
- 9aa5c15a66c64a8620e94cb7d1337fcb28a41653269576567cede6d51fd40dbb
- confirmations
- 388517
- spent
- true